NASCAR is all about cars, and cars are all about horsepower, and NASCAR’s history with horsepower rules kicked off in the late 1980s after Bobby Allison’s crash in 1987. This led to the introduction of restrictor plates in 1988 to curb speeds and enhance safety on superspeedways. Fast forward to 2022, when the Next Gen car rolled out with a baseline of 670 horsepower at most tracks, a deliberate drop from previous levels to prioritize parity and cost control. But that adjustment sparked ongoing debates in the garage about throttle response and on-track action.

What is the logic behind the sudden 750-horsepower jump?
The push for a horsepower boost stems from widespread feedback highlighting the need for more dynamic racing, especially where current setups limit passing and throttle control. Drivers and teams have voiced frustrations with the 670-horsepower baseline, arguing it hampers excitement on certain layouts, prompting NASCAR to explore increments that enhance performance without overhauling the entire system. Engine builders see the jump to 750 as manageable, noting it aligns closely with existing capabilities and avoids extreme modifications that could strain resources.
This calculated step reflects a broader effort to respond to stakeholder input while maintaining economic viability for the sport. As NASCAR President Steve O’Donnell explained on the Dale Jr. Download, “So, why 750? Why not 800? Why not 1,000? So, if you look at where we are today, where can we go without completely changing over the industry?” His point underscores the balance between innovation and practicality, ensuring the change builds on the Next Gen framework rather than disrupting it entirely.

Which tracks will feature the 750 HP package?
NASCAR has specified that the 750-horsepower setup will apply to all road courses and ovals shorter than 1.5 miles, targeting environments where additional power can amplify competition and passing opportunities. This includes circuits like Watkins Glen International, Sonoma Raceway, and the Charlotte ROVAL, alongside ovals such as Martinsville Speedway, Bristol Motor Speedway, and Dover Motor Speedway. The selection prioritizes layouts where throttle finesse plays a bigger role, aiming to elevate the racing product without affecting longer intermediates or super speedways.
Among the likely candidates are short tracks like Richmond Raceway and Iowa Speedway, plus mid-length ovals, including Nashville Superspeedway at 1.33 miles, where the boost could transform strategies around tire management and acceleration out of corners. John Probst, NASCAR’s chief racing development officer, noted in discussions, “We’ve been doing a lot of work with the tires, and we think we’ve put on some pretty good short track races. These engines will work the tires more.” This approach ensures the package fits tracks, emphasizing power over aerodynamic dominance.

Who were the key players who helped in finalizing this change?
Driver input proved crucial in finalizing the horsepower adjustment, with voices from the cockpit emphasizing the need for better throttle response to improve overtaking and overall race quality. Teams and original equipment manufacturers (OEMs) like Chevrolet, Ford, and Toyota also weighed in, supporting a modest increase that aligns with their engineering priorities and long-term investments in the sport. Potential entrants such as Dodge added to the conversation, favoring changes that foster stability.
NASCAR executives, particularly President Steve O’Donnell, played a central role in synthesizing this feedback into actionable policy. Backed by figures like John Probst, the process involved extensive consultations to ensure broad buy-in. Probst highlighted the collaborative nature, stating, “We listen to the fans a lot. We listen to the drivers. We have stakeholders in the broadcast, OEM (manufacturers), and team competition and team business folks, so there’s always no shortage of feedback that we get.” This inclusive strategy helped lock in the update for 2026.

When & where will testing happen? What is the timeline expectation?
NASCAR has firmly stated that no horsepower modifications will occur before the 2026 season, allowing teams ample preparation time to adapt without mid-cycle disruptions. The 750 package is slated to debut in select events that year, specifically at the designated road courses and shorter ovals, marking a phased introduction to gauge real-world impacts.
While full details on testing venues and schedules remain limited, an offseason tire test with Goodyear is planned at North Wilkesboro Speedway to refine compounds suited to the higher output. This step ensures compatibility across components, building confidence ahead of the season opener. As O’Donnell shared, the emphasis is on a measured rollout to support ongoing partnerships.

What are the anticipated challenges and benefits, and what to watch for
The horsepower hike could transform competition by enabling more aggressive passing, varied car setups, and a greater premium on driver skill, particularly in managing throttle through corners. Benefits include heightened excitement for fans, as the added power tests finesse and creates unpredictable battles, potentially revitalizing short-track action that has drawn criticism in recent years.
Challenges center on durability, with increased stress on engine internals raising concerns about wear under the league’s two-race engine rule. O’Donnell cautioned, “If you went beyond 750, we looked at almost $40-50 million in costs to the industry,” highlighting risks like higher transition expenses and the need to balance speed with reliability. Watch how teams navigate these factors, from engine longevity to cost controls, as the change unfolds.
